#9f5873 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#9f5873 is composed of 62.4% red, 34.5% green and 45.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 44.7% magenta, 27.7% yellow and 37.6% black. It has a hue angle of 337.2 degrees, a saturation of 28.7% and a lightness of 48.4%. #9f5873 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ffb0e6 with #3f0000. Closest websafe color is: #996666.

Shades and Tints of #9f5873

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070405 is the darkest color, while #fcfafb is the lightest one.

Tones of #9f5873

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#83757a is the less saturated color, while #f5025f is the most saturated one.
